Nigeria Postage Due Stamp
Nigeria · 1965 · 1d
This stamp is part of Nigeria's first postage due series issued after becoming a republic. The design is simple and functional, featuring a large numeral '1' indicating the one penny denomination, framed by an ornamental design with 'NIGERIA' inscribed at the top and 'POSTAGE DUE' at the bottom.
Issued in 1965, this series reflects the early years of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, which was established in 1963. Postage due stamps were used to collect payment for mail that was sent with insufficient postage.
